Capstone — Integrated Glycomics/Glycoproteomics Project — Hands-on

Apply everything learned across glycomics and glycoproteomics modules in a guided, end-to-end capstone. You will take curated RAW files and processed tables through QC, identification review, quantitative summaries, biological interpretation and FAIR-style reporting to deliver a coherent mini-project suitable for slides, manuscripts or stakeholder review.
